Error: Discarding duplicate request from client
hello I am getting lot of error messages in radius logs saying Fri Nov 3 14:26:03 2017 : Error: Discarding duplicate request from client CCR port 59350 - ID: 202 due to unfinished request 12 in component post-auth module exec. When users are trying to loh=gin in the NAS I can see in NAS logs that radius is timing out, what could be the reason for this? The exec module is running a script, and that script is taking a long time.
When users are trying to loh=gin in the NAS I can see in NAS logs that radius is timing out, what could be the reason for this?
You configured the server to run a script, and the script takes a long time. Fix that. If the script takes more than 1ms to run, it's wrong. If it takes 10s to run, then the script is very, very, wrong. Fix the script. It's breaking the server. Alan DeKok.

On 20/11/2017, at 5:17 PM, Krauss International <sanman.krauss@gmail.com> wrote:
Alan, Thanks for your reply I have been searching for a resolution on this How do I get to know the amount of time script is taking to execute? Also, could it be a problem that the script is in perl and taking long time?
That is a very broad question, and there isn’t any debug info provided to aid even a guess at why it’s taking it a long time. Running a perl script through the exec module sounds like a great way to slow down the server though, loading the perl interpreter every time can’t be fast. Any reason you’re not running it in rlm_perl? This would keep your perl interpreter and script in memory in the freeradius process, and make things a lot quicker than calling it with exec.

On Nov 19, 2017, at 11:17 PM, Krauss International <sanman.krauss@gmail.com> wrote:
Alan, Thanks for your reply I have been searching for a resolution on this How do I get to know the amount of time script is taking to execute?
Run it in debug mode and look at it. Or, instrument your script using standard Unix tools.
Also, could it be a problem that the script is in perl and taking long time?
That's what I said. Use rlm_perl. It will help a little bit. But... your script is probably doing lots of complex things. That's wrong. In the most extreme case, your script should take no more than 1ms to run. If it *ever* takes longer than that, fix it. Alan DeKok.
